Skills Taught

  • How to monitor vitals such as
    • Blood pressure
    • Pulse
    • Respirations
    • Oxygen saturations
    • Blood glucose
  • CPR
  • Monitoring health status
  • Feeding
  • Bathing
  • Dressing
  • Grooming
  • Toileting
  • Assisting mobility needs

Career Options for Graduates

Upon successful completion of the program and passing the Office of the Utah Nursing Assistant Registry (OUNAR) State Exams, students will be prepared for entry-level positions in the following settings:

  • Nursing Care Facilities
  • General Medical and Surgical Hospitals
  • Doctors Office
  • Continuing Care Retirement Communities
  • Assisted Living Facilities
  • Home Health Services
  • Hospice Care
  • Individual and Family Services

Program Requirements

1. Apply to Snow College

Complete your application to Snow College before registering for the course.

2. Register for the Course

This course does not offer online registration. To enroll, contact a Health Professions advisor:

  • Ephraim: 435-283-7332
  • Richfield: 435-893-2211

Registration priority is given to adult students and high school seniors.

High School Student Requirements
  • Must be at least 16 years old and a junior by the first day of class
  • Must have a GPA of 3.0 or higher

3. Submit Health Requirements

  • Provide proof of a negative TB test. Students with a positive TB test must submit a chest X-ray.
  • Provide COVID vaccination documentation. Unvaccinated students may request a waiver from the instructor during the first week of class.

4. Complete a Background Check


Time Commitment

  • 90 hours of classroom and lab instruction
  • 24 hours of clinical experience (completed outside scheduled class time)

Transportation

Students are responsible for their own transportation to and from clinical sites.
